Fr. Vasco Milani Mission Departure Ceremony at St. Charles Borromeo, Milwaukeewonderful mission sending celebration took place at St. Charles Borromeo Church in Milwaukee, on Sunday Jan. 26, 2003, with the presence of Archbishop Timothy DolanFr. Vasco Milani was the honored guest and the one "sent" by this local church, to the communities of Belem, Brazil.  The Readings of this Sunday Mass fit well the message of Mission, as Jesus called his disciples to follow him.  Bishop Dolan invited the over 600 participants to reflect on the two aspects of following the Lord: "to come" to the Lord, and "to go" to bring the Good News.

The inspiring celebration, enriched by meaningful music, with bell choir, brass and organ, the participation of Eucharistic ministers, school children's gifts, congregation's applauses and singing, the presence of members of the parish, St. Joan Antida sisters, and of the Xaverian friends from all-over Wisconsin and Illinois, the leadership and friendship of Fr. Tony Zimmer... all of these aspects made the celebration even more beautiful.  How good it is when God's people gather together in the Lord.

A potluck of all sorts of goodies and sandwiches followed the Eucharistic Celebration, and all had a chance to meet Archbishop Timothy and Fr. Vasco.  Their smiles are contagious, and their dedication to following the Lord a true inspiration for all.  As Fr. Vasco leaves for his mission assignment, he treasures the memories of this even in his heart: "Here I am, Lord...  I will hold your people in my heart."
